je suppose que plusieurs personnes ont déjà eu ce problème ! Nous avons un
bouton image sur une page aspx et lorsque l'utilisateur clique sur le bouton,
le code est exécuté. Le problème est que lorsque l'action du bouton dure trop
long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ui a pour
effet de faire deux fois le code !!!
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
Simon Mourier
Normalement avec un "user agent" (Internet Explorer, Firefox, ...) normal et un bouton normal, ce n'est pas possible. A moins que le code serveur lui-même renvoie la même page avec le même bouton (même temporairement), ou que la page elle-même soit programmée avec des scripts, des délais, des splash, ou d'autres choses "folkloriques".
On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ois, mais le submit n'a pas en fait été envoyé deux fois.
Bref, c'est en général un problème de développement de l'applicatif lui-même.
Simon. www.softfluent.com
"Alain Rogister" a écrit dans le message de news:
Bonjour,
je suppose que plusieurs personnes ont déjà eu ce problème ! Nous avons un bouton image sur une page aspx et lorsque l'utilisateur clique sur le bouton, le code est exécuté. Le problème est que lorsque l'action du bouton dure trop long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ui a pour effet de faire deux fois le code !!!
Quelqu'un a-t-il une solution pour ce problème ?
Merci
Alain
Normalement avec un "user agent" (Internet Explorer, Firefox, ...) normal et
un bouton normal, ce n'est pas possible. A moins que le code serveur
lui-même renvoie la même page avec le même bouton (même temporairement), ou
que la page elle-même soit programmée avec des scripts, des délais, des
splash, ou d'autres choses "folkloriques".
On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ois, mais le
submit n'a pas en fait été envoyé deux fois.
Bref, c'est en général un problème de développement de l'applicatif
lui-même.
Simon.
www.softfluent.com
"Alain Rogister" <AlainRogister@discussions.microsoft.com> a écrit dans le
message de news: C8623D93-EAFE-43FF-AF50-7D525F07E239@microsoft.com...
Bonjour,
je suppose que plusieurs personnes ont déjà eu ce problème ! Nous avons un
bouton image sur une page aspx et lorsque l'utilisateur clique sur le
bouton,
le code est exécuté. Le problème est que lorsque l'action du bouton dure
trop
long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ui a
pour
effet de faire deux fois le code !!!
Normalement avec un "user agent" (Internet Explorer, Firefox, ...) normal et un bouton normal, ce n'est pas possible. A moins que le code serveur lui-même renvoie la même page avec le même bouton (même temporairement), ou que la page elle-même soit programmée avec des scripts, des délais, des splash, ou d'autres choses "folkloriques".
On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ois, mais le submit n'a pas en fait été envoyé deux fois.
Bref, c'est en général un problème de développement de l'applicatif lui-même.
Simon. www.softfluent.com
"Alain Rogister" a écrit dans le message de news:
Bonjour,
je suppose que plusieurs personnes ont déjà eu ce problème ! Nous avons un bouton image sur une page aspx et lorsque l'utilisateur clique sur le bouton, le code est exécuté. Le problème est que lorsque l'action du bouton dure trop long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ui a pour effet de faire deux fois le code !!!
Quelqu'un a-t-il une solution pour ce problème ?
Merci
Alain
Alain Rogister
En fait, il s'agit d'une image encapsulée dans des références HTML <a> </a>.
Et là, j'ai eu le cas. Lorsque le serveur ne répond pas directement, l'utilisateur a cliqué une deuxième fois en se disant qu'il n'avait pas cliqué, et il a effectué l'opération deux fois ! Ce qui est très ennuyeux !
Une solution ?
"Simon Mourier" a écrit :
Normalement avec un "user agent" (Internet Explorer, Firefox, ...) normal et un bouton normal, ce n'est pas possible. A moins que le code serveur lui-même renvoie la même page avec le même bouton (même temporairement), ou que la page elle-même soit programmée avec des scripts, des délais, des splash, ou d'autres choses "folkloriques".
On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ois, mais le submit n'a pas en fait été envoyé deux fois.
Bref, c'est en général un problème de développement de l'applicatif lui-même.
Simon. www.softfluent.com
"Alain Rogister" a écrit dans le message de news: > Bonjour, > > je suppose que plusieurs personnes ont déjà eu ce problème ! Nous avons un > bouton image sur une page aspx et lorsque l'utilisateur clique sur le > bouton, > le code est exécuté. Le problème est que lorsque l'action du bouton dure > trop > long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ui a > pour > effet de faire deux fois le code !!! > > Quelqu'un a-t-il une solution pour ce problème ? > > Merci > > Alain
En fait, il s'agit d'une image encapsulée dans des références HTML <a> </a>.
Et là, j'ai eu le cas. Lorsque le serveur ne répond pas directement,
l'utilisateur a cliqué une deuxième fois en se disant qu'il n'avait pas
cliqué, et il a effectué l'opération deux fois ! Ce qui est très ennuyeux !
Une solution ?
"Simon Mourier" a écrit :
Normalement avec un "user agent" (Internet Explorer, Firefox, ...) normal et
un bouton normal, ce n'est pas possible. A moins que le code serveur
lui-même renvoie la même page avec le même bouton (même temporairement), ou
que la page elle-même soit programmée avec des scripts, des délais, des
splash, ou d'autres choses "folkloriques".
On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ois, mais le
submit n'a pas en fait été envoyé deux fois.
Bref, c'est en général un problème de développement de l'applicatif
lui-même.
Simon.
www.softfluent.com
"Alain Rogister" <AlainRogister@discussions.microsoft.com> a écrit dans le
message de news: C8623D93-EAFE-43FF-AF50-7D525F07E239@microsoft.com...
> Bonjour,
>
> je suppose que plusieurs personnes ont déjà eu ce problème ! Nous avons un
> bouton image sur une page aspx et lorsque l'utilisateur clique sur le
> bouton,
> le code est exécuté. Le problème est que lorsque l'action du bouton dure
> trop
> long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ui a
> pour
> effet de faire deux fois le code !!!
>
> Quelqu'un a-t-il une solution pour ce problème ?
>
> Merci
>
> Alain
En fait, il s'agit d'une image encapsulée dans des références HTML <a> </a>.
Et là, j'ai eu le cas. Lorsque le serveur ne répond pas directement, l'utilisateur a cliqué une deuxième fois en se disant qu'il n'avait pas cliqué, et il a effectué l'opération deux fois ! Ce qui est très ennuyeux !
Une solution ?
"Simon Mourier" a écrit :
Normalement avec un "user agent" (Internet Explorer, Firefox, ...) normal et un bouton normal, ce n'est pas possible. A moins que le code serveur lui-même renvoie la même page avec le même bouton (même temporairement), ou que la page elle-même soit programmée avec des scripts, des délais, des splash, ou d'autres choses "folkloriques".
On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ois, mais le submit n'a pas en fait été envoyé deux fois.
Bref, c'est en général un problème de développement de l'applicatif lui-même.
Simon. www.softfluent.com
"Alain Rogister" a écrit dans le message de news: > Bonjour, > > je suppose que plusieurs personnes ont déjà eu ce problème ! Nous avons un > bouton image sur une page aspx et lorsque l'utilisateur clique sur le > bouton, > le code est exécuté. Le problème est que lorsque l'action du bouton dure > trop > long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ui a > pour > effet de faire deux fois le code !!! > > Quelqu'un a-t-il une solution pour ce problème ? > > Merci > > Alain
Paul Bacelar
http://msdn.microsoft.com/msdnmag/issues/03/12/DesignPatterns/ -- Paul Bacelar
"Alain Rogister" wrote in message news:
En fait, il s'agit d'une image encapsulée dans des références HTML <a>
</a>.
Et là, j'ai eu le cas. Lorsque le serveur ne répond pas directement, l'utilisateur a cliqué une deuxième fois en se disant qu'il n'avait pas cliqué, et il a effectué l'opération deux fois ! Ce qui est très ennuyeux
!
Une solution ?
"Simon Mourier" a écrit :
> Normalement avec un "user agent" (Internet Explorer, Firefox, ...)
normal et
> un bouton normal, ce n'est pas possible. A moins que le code serveur > lui-même renvoie la même page avec le même bouton (même temporairement),
ou
> que la page elle-même soit programmée avec des scripts, des délais, des > splash, ou d'autres choses "folkloriques". > > On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ois,
mais le
> submit n'a pas en fait été envoyé deux fois. > > Bref, c'est en général un problème de développement de l'applicatif > lui-même. > > Simon. > www.softfluent.com > > > "Alain Rogister" a écrit dans
le
> message de news: > > Bonjour, > > > > je suppose que plusieurs personnes ont déjà eu ce problème ! Nous
avons un
> > bouton image sur une page aspx et lorsque l'utilisateur clique sur le > > bouton, > > le code est exécuté. Le problème est que lorsque l'action du bouton
dure
> > trop > > long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ui
a
> > pour > > effet de faire deux fois le code !!! > > > > Quelqu'un a-t-il une solution pour ce problème ? > > > > Merci > > > > Alain > > >
http://msdn.microsoft.com/msdnmag/issues/03/12/DesignPatterns/
--
Paul Bacelar
"Alain Rogister" <AlainRogister@discussions.microsoft.com> wrote in message
news:E52DF9C4-6381-40BE-B831-5B68E2A7262D@microsoft.com...
En fait, il s'agit d'une image encapsulée dans des références HTML <a>
</a>.
Et là, j'ai eu le cas. Lorsque le serveur ne répond pas directement,
l'utilisateur a cliqué une deuxième fois en se disant qu'il n'avait pas
cliqué, et il a effectué l'opération deux fois ! Ce qui est très ennuyeux
!
Une solution ?
"Simon Mourier" a écrit :
> Normalement avec un "user agent" (Internet Explorer, Firefox, ...)
normal et
> un bouton normal, ce n'est pas possible. A moins que le code serveur
> lui-même renvoie la même page avec le même bouton (même temporairement),
ou
> que la page elle-même soit programmée avec des scripts, des délais, des
> splash, ou d'autres choses "folkloriques".
>
> On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ois,
mais le
> submit n'a pas en fait été envoyé deux fois.
>
> Bref, c'est en général un problème de développement de l'applicatif
> lui-même.
>
> Simon.
> www.softfluent.com
>
>
> "Alain Rogister" <AlainRogister@discussions.microsoft.com> a écrit dans
le
> message de news: C8623D93-EAFE-43FF-AF50-7D525F07E239@microsoft.com...
> > Bonjour,
> >
> > je suppose que plusieurs personnes ont déjà eu ce problème ! Nous
avons un
> > bouton image sur une page aspx et lorsque l'utilisateur clique sur le
> > bouton,
> > le code est exécuté. Le problème est que lorsque l'action du bouton
dure
> > trop
> > long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ui
a
> > pour
> > effet de faire deux fois le code !!!
> >
> > Quelqu'un a-t-il une solution pour ce problème ?
> >
> > Merci
> >
> > Alain
>
>
>
http://msdn.microsoft.com/msdnmag/issues/03/12/DesignPatterns/ -- Paul Bacelar
"Alain Rogister" wrote in message news:
En fait, il s'agit d'une image encapsulée dans des références HTML <a>
</a>.
Et là, j'ai eu le cas. Lorsque le serveur ne répond pas directement, l'utilisateur a cliqué une deuxième fois en se disant qu'il n'avait pas cliqué, et il a effectué l'opération deux fois ! Ce qui est très ennuyeux
!
Une solution ?
"Simon Mourier" a écrit :
> Normalement avec un "user agent" (Internet Explorer, Firefox, ...)
normal et
> un bouton normal, ce n'est pas possible. A moins que le code serveur > lui-même renvoie la même page avec le même bouton (même temporairement),
ou
> que la page elle-même soit programmée avec des scripts, des délais, des > splash, ou d'autres choses "folkloriques". > > On peut aussi penser ou avoir l'impression qu'on a cliqué deux fois,
mais le
> submit n'a pas en fait été envoyé deux fois. > > Bref, c'est en général un problème de développement de l'applicatif > lui-même. > > Simon. > www.softfluent.com > > > "Alain Rogister" a écrit dans
le
> message de news: > > Bonjour, > > > > je suppose que plusieurs personnes ont déjà eu ce problème ! Nous
avons un
> > bouton image sur une page aspx et lorsque l'utilisateur clique sur le > > bouton, > > le code est exécuté. Le problème est que lorsque l'action du bouton
dure
> > trop > > longtemps, l'utilisateur a tendance à recliquer dessus desuite, ce qui
a
> > pour > > effet de faire deux fois le code !!! > > > > Quelqu'un a-t-il une solution pour ce problème ? > > > > Merci > > > > Alain > > >